Flexential Secures $800 Million for Data Center Development



Flexential, a prominent name in secure and flexible data center solutions, recently announced a groundbreaking development: the establishment of an $800 million credit facility. This capital infusion is targeted at enhancing the company’s data center capabilities in key markets across the United States, where customer demand continues to surge. With over 130 megawatts (MW) of new capacity planned, this initiative signals Flexential’s commitment to meeting the evolving demands of enterprise clients, particularly as the need for AI-driven infrastructure escalates.

The Scope of Development



The newly structured financing will directly support several major projects currently in the pipeline. Among these are significant facilities under construction, including a 36 MW site in Atlanta-Douglasville, Georgia, a similar capacity facility in Portland-Hillsboro, Oregon, and a 22.5 MW project located in Denver-Parker, Colorado. Additionally, plans are underway for another substantial 36 MW facility in Portland-Hillsboro and a 4.5 MW expansion adjacent to its current operations in Atlanta-Norcross, Georgia. Financing Details



This particular financing is a significant milestone for Flexential, as it was oversubscribed, increasing its original target of $500 million by an impressive 60%. A consortium of 11 leading banks, known for their expertise in digital infrastructure, supported the facility. Notably, TD Securities played a crucial role as the administrative agent and joint lead arranger. Other major financial institutions involved included RBC Capital Markets and J.P. Morgan, among others, highlighting the strong confidence the financial sector has in Flexential’s growth strategy.

The capital structure will facilitate the transition of Flexential's projects from planning through to construction and delivery seamlessly. The initiative complements ongoing equity investments from Flexential’s sponsors, GI Partners and MSIP, ensuring that the company remains on a firm footing moving forward.
